"We hereby find our enforcers not guilty," said the District Attorney. Just joking, but that's essentially what just happened. Via The Sacramento Bee: The pepper-spraying of students by UC Davis police officers last November was not criminal conduct, Yolo County District Attorney's office concluded Wednesday following an inquiry into officers' response to protestors on the campus.Fortunately, the pepper sprayed students at least won a settlement off the college, they report the college lost "more than $1 million in legal and other fees." |
